OFFENTLIG Fra: Mie Lucia Brokmose Thobo-Carlsen <mie.thobo-carlsen@unwomen.org> Sendt: 3. november 2025 13:37 Til: Mie Lucia Brokmose Thobo-Carlsen <mie.thobo-carlsen@unwomen.org> Emne: [Invite] 10 November: UN Women and Danish MFA invite you to attend UN City launch: "When Data Speaks: Accelerating Equality - SDG Gender Snapshot 2025" [Sent BBC to partners of the UN Women Nordic Office] WHEN DATA SPEAKS: ACCELERATING EQUALITY BY 2030 Danish launch of the Progress on the Sustainable Development Goals: The Gender Snapshot 2025 Date: Monday, 10 November 2025 Time: 09:00 – 10:30 Venue: UN City, Pacific Lounge, Marmorvej 51, 2100 København Ø Join UN Women and the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Denmark for the Danish launch of the UN report Progress on the Sustainable Development Goals: The Gender Snapshot 2025 – the annual flagship report by UN Women and the UN Department of Economic and Social Affairs (UN DESA). This year’s edition comes at a pivotal moment: 30 years after the adoption of the Beijing Declaration and Platform for Action, and only five years until the 2030 deadline to achieve the Sustainable Development Goals. It is a time to take stock of progress, confront persistent and emerging challenges, and renew our collective commitment to gender equality, women’s empowerment, and sustainable development. The launch will spotlight the report’s key findings and provide space for reflection on how Denmark and global partners can accelerate progress. Read the report here.
